@charset "UTF-8";.section-about{color:#636363;margin-top:38px;padding-top:40px;padding-bottom:60px}.section-about .headline__title{font-size:1.4rem;font-weight:700;color:#325869;text-align:center;line-height:1}.section-about .headline__title span{font-family:filson-pro,sans-serif;font-size:2.4rem;font-weight:700;margin-right:8px}.section-about .headline__lead{font-family:Noto Sans JP,游ゴシック,YuGothic,メイリオ,Meiryo,ＭＳ Ｐゴシック,MS PGothic,Helvetica,Arial,Verdana,sans-serif;color:#325869;margin-top:28px;padding:0 12px}.section-about .headline .btn-wrap{margin-top:28px}.section-about .content{margin-top:36px;padding-top:36px;border-top:1px solid #636363}.section-about .about-box.wh{background-color:#fefefe;padding:20px;border-radius:8px;-webkit-filter:0 0 4px rgba(113,113,113,.1);filter:0 0 4px rgba(113,113,113,.1)}.section-about .about-box+.about-box{margin-top:12px}.section-about .about__img img{border-radius:4px;width:100%}.section-about .about-hgroup{display:-webkit-box;display:-ms-flexbox;display:flex;margin-top:12px}.section-about .about__title{color:#325869}.section-about .about__title.en{font-family:filson-pro,sans-serif;font-size:2rem;font-weight:700}.section-about .about__title.jp{font-family:Noto Sans JP,游ゴシック,YuGothic,メイリオ,Meiryo,ＭＳ Ｐゴシック,MS PGothic,Helvetica,Arial,Verdana,sans-serif;font-size:1.2rem;font-weight:700;margin-top:6px;margin-left:8px}.section-about .about__text.small{font-size:1rem}.section-about .howto-box.wh{background-color:#fefefe;padding:20px;border-radius:8px;-webkit-filter:0 0 4px rgba(113,113,113,.1);filter:0 0 4px rgba(113,113,113,.1)}.section-about .howto-box+.howto-box{margin-top:12px}.section-about .howto__img img{border-radius:4px;width:100%}.section-about .howto__title{font-size:1.4rem;font-weight:700;text-align:center;color:#325869;margin-top:8px}.section-about .howto__text{margin-top:4px}.section-about .howto__text.small{font-size:1rem}.section-about .price.wh{background-color:#fefefe;padding:20px;border-radius:8px;-webkit-filter:0 0 4px rgba(113,113,113,.1);filter:0 0 4px rgba(113,113,113,.1)}.section-about .price__text{font-family:Noto Sans JP,游ゴシック,YuGothic,メイリオ,Meiryo,ＭＳ Ｐゴシック,MS PGothic,Helvetica,Arial,Verdana,sans-serif}.section-about .price__text.small{font-size:1rem}.section-about .price-value{color:#fefefe;background:#325869;border-radius:4px;margin-top:8px;padding:8px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;min-height:50px}.section-about .price-value__text{font-size:1.6rem;font-weight:700}.section-about .price-value__text span{font-size:1.2rem;font-weight:700;margin-left:4px}.section-about .price-value+.price-notes{margin-top:8px}.section-about .price-notes{font-size:1rem}.section-about .price-notes.center{text-align:center}.section-about .price-notes+.price__text.small{margin-top:4px}.section-about .price-notes+.price__text.small a{text-decoration:underline}.section-about .price-notes-item:before{content:"※"}.section-about .price-notes-item a{text-decoration:underline}.section-about .payment{margin-top:24px;font-family:Noto Sans JP,游ゴシック,YuGothic,メイリオ,Meiryo,ＭＳ Ｐゴシック,MS PGothic,Helvetica,Arial,Verdana,sans-serif}.section-about .payment__title{font-size:1.4rem;font-weight:700;color:#325869;text-align:center}.section-about .payment-box{margin-top:12px;padding:20px;border:1px solid #e2e7e6;border-radius:8px}.section-about .payment-item{position:relative;font-size:1.2rem;font-weight:700;color:#325869;padding-left:26px}.section-about .payment-item:before{content:"";display:inline-block;width:4px;height:4px;background-color:#325869;border-radius:50%;position:absolute;top:7px;left:7px}.section-about .payment-item+.payment-item{margin-top:4px}.section-about .plan{margin-top:24px}.section-about .plan__title{font-size:1.4rem;font-weight:700;color:#325869;text-align:center}.section-about .plan-list{margin-top:12px;display:-webkit-box;display:-ms-flexbox;display:flex;gap:8px}.section-about .plan-list+.price-notes{margin-top:12px}.section-about .plan-item{width:33.3333333333%;text-align:center;position:relative;border:1px solid #e2e7e6;border-radius:4px;overflow:hidden}.section-about .plan__subtitle{font-size:1rem;font-weight:500;color:#fefefe;background-color:#325869;padding:4px 2px}.section-about .plan__price{font-family:Noto Sans JP,游ゴシック,YuGothic,メイリオ,Meiryo,ＭＳ Ｐゴシック,MS PGothic,Helvetica,Arial,Verdana,sans-serif;color:#325869;font-size:1.2rem;font-weight:700;padding:8px 4px}.section-about .plan__price span{font-size:1rem;font-weight:400}.section-about .join,.section-about .join-content{margin-top:24px}.section-about .join__text{font-size:1.4rem;color:#343434;text-align:center}.section-about .join .btn-wrap{margin-top:24px}.tabnav__btn{font-family:Noto Sans JP,游ゴシック,YuGothic,メイリオ,Meiryo,ＭＳ Ｐゴシック,MS PGothic,Helvetica,Arial,Verdana,sans-serif;font-size:1rem;font-weight:500;padding:1.25em 0}.tab-box{margin-top:24px}